What is a Registered Agent?
A registered agent is an individual appointed to receive legal documents on behalf of a company. registered agent privacy protection is essential for guaranteeing that a firm can be easily contacted by regulatory bodies and is compliant with state regulations. The designated agent acts as the official point of contact for court actions, including subpoenas, tax documents, and other important communications.

Agent provisions are usually necessary for multiple business entities, including limited liability companies and corporate entities. Each state has particular registered agent criteria, mandating that the registered agent must have a physical address within the jurisdiction where the entity is formed. This location, often referred to as the official address, cannot be a mailbox, guaranteeing that legal documents can be received in person reliably.

Opting for a reliable registered agent company is crucial for maintaining compliance and ensuring efficient business operations. This can include contracting a regional registered agent who is acquainted with state regulations or choosing an internet-based agent service, which can provide more flexibility and ease. Regardless of the decision, the designated agent is a key component of business governance, aiding in statutory compliance and helping to preserve the legal validity of the corporate body.

Designated Agent Criteria and Rules
When setting up a business, understanding the agent of record requirements is essential for compliance. A designated agent must be appointed to handle legal documents and service of process on behalf of the business. Typically, this representative must live in the corresponding state where the firm is registered and be available during standard office hours to handle important notifications. Most states allow businesses to appoint an individual or a professional registered agent, but the designated agent must maintain a tangible location, as P.O. boxes are generally not acceptable.

In also to location obligations, registered agents must comply with specific regulations concerning their duties. They are charged with ensuring prompt receipt of official communications, maintaining exact records, and ensuring compliance with state filings. Each state has its own collection of regulations regarding the functioning of registered agents, including guidelines on confidentiality and management client information. This highlights the significance of choosing a dependable registered agent that can meet regulatory standards.

Costs Related to Registered Agent Services
The fees associated with registered agent services can differ considerably depending on various factors, including the company, venue, and the specific services available. On average, annual costs for registered agent services generally fall between $one hundred to $three hundred. This cost usually includes necessary services such as handling court correspondences, overseeing the service of process, and offering a registered address. However, extra fees may be applicable for extra offerings including notification services or recurring filing reports.

How to Update Your Registered Agent
Changing one's appointed representative represents a simple process which involves adhering to certain steps dictated by one's state’s regulations. To begin this change, you must initially select a new registered representative that satisfies all statutory criteria in your region, confirming that the agent is either a inhabitant of the state or a credentialed registered agent company. Once you have selected a new representative, it is crucial to complete the appropriate change form issued by one's state’s business registry. This form typically includes information about your business, your current registered agent, and a new agent.

After filling the change form, file it to the designated state agency, generally the Secretary of State. In addition to the form, you might have to pay a fee, that changes depending on the state and the registered agent service that you are utilizing. Pay attention of any additional requirements which may be present, such as alerting your current registered agent about the alteration. This guarantees a seamless transition and avoids any disruptions in one's service of process delivery.

Ultimately, once one's application is accepted, the state will update their documentation to reflect one's updated registered agent. It is recommended to check that the change has been finalized by checking the documentation using your state’s business entity portal. Additionally, keep a copy of the confirmation for one's records and ensure that one's new registered agent is adequately equipped with necessary responsibilities, including regulatory reminders and managing legal documents moving going forward.
